What is wild sockeye salmon?

The pristine Pacific seas are the source of wild sockeye salmon, which is prized for its strong flavor and vivid red color. Wild sockeye salmon’s natural diet, as opposed to farmed salmon, improves its flavor and nutritional value. It is a favorite among people looking for a fish that is full of omega-3 fatty acids and has a delicious flavor.

Nutritional Benefits of Wild Sockeye Salmon

Wild sockeye salmon is a nutrient-dense powerhouse. It is rich in vital minerals like selenium, omega-3 fatty acids, and vitamins B12 and D. This makes it a beneficial supplement to any diet, promoting brain function, heart health, and general well-being.

What to avoid when buying salmon?

Avoid purchasing salmon that has mushy textures, strong fishy smells, or dull colors. Go for firmness and vivid, colorful flesh. Make sure the salmon you’re buying is wild-caught by always looking for obvious labeling.

Is Costco Wild Sockeye Salmon sushi-grade?

Costco does not label its salmon as sushi-grade, so it’s best cooked before consumption.

How can I tell if Costco salmon is fresh? 

Fresh salmon has bright, vibrant flesh, a mild scent, and a firm texture.
